Modern cinema has shifted from the "wicked stepmother" tropes of the past toward more nuanced, empathetic, and often humorous portrayals of blended family life. While early films often relied on conflict as the primary engine for drama, contemporary stories increasingly focus on the effort required to build a "new normal" where love is a choice rather than a biological default.
